- **Event Description**: Get ready for an evening of suspense with Toronto research lawyer Emma White as she shares the story behind her gripping debut thriller, Venom Lake. When four friends from a true‑crime book club head to remote Snakebite Island for a carefree girls’ weekend, their getaway takes a chilling turn—one of them ends up dead, and the others are left to untangle the danger closing in around them.

Packed with twists, dark secrets, and a tense island setting, Venom Lake is perfect for fans of Lisa Jewell, Lucy Foley, and Ashley Audrain. Join us for a conversation about crafting page‑turning suspense, complicated friendships, and what makes a thriller truly unputdownable.
